Transaction 70324e121e66e4e33eaaf8352b83835b260a5e40c81a884f516b100086d4541b

1 Input
2 Outputs
  • 70324e121e66e4e33eaaf8352b83835b260a5e40c81a884f516b100086d4541b:0
  • value  748020
    address  3Myo6yDNoCEfoGPPmckfDYP8JwZqavqjNR
  • 70324e121e66e4e33eaaf8352b83835b260a5e40c81a884f516b100086d4541b:1
  • value  1761128
    address  19AYVWx2uLkWabsuSh42prfnGNtzM2HXKx